USAC/CRA SPRINT CARS RETURN TO PERRIS FOR “SALUTE TO INDY”
By Lance Jennings

MAY 24, 2016... This Saturday, May 28th, the Amsoil USAC/CRA Sprint Car Series will battle at Don Kazarian’s Perris Auto Speedway for the annual “Salute to Indy.” “The Power of Purple Night” benefiting the City of Perris Relay For Life and the American Cancer Society will also feature the PAS Senior Sprint Cars, PAS Young Gun Sprint Cars, and the California Lightning Sprints. Located on the Lake Perris Fairgrounds in Perris, California, the spectator gates at "America's Premier Dirt Track" will open at 5:00pm and racing is scheduled for 7:00pm. The annual "Salute to Indy" has been a Southern California tradition going back to 1948 when Dempsey Wilson claimed the checkered flags with the original California Racing Association. When Perris Auto Speedway opened their doors in 1996, the Riverside County oval kept the tradition alive and current NASCAR competitor J.J. Yeley scored the victory. Last year, Richard Vander Weerd took command from Matt Mitchell and added the “Salute to Indy” win to his resume.

Since March 6, 2004, the Lake Perris Fairgrounds has held 183 USAC/CRA Sprint Car events. “The Demon” Damion Gardner leads all drivers with 37 victories and Nic Faas set the 1-lap qualifying record of 15.833 on February 25, 2012. In the two previous visits of 2016, Indiana’s Bryan Clauson and New Mexico’s Josh Hodges earned wins at USAC/CRA’s ‘home track.” A complete Perris series win list is at the end of this release.

Entering the fourth point race, Brody Roa (Garden Grove, California) leads the chase for the championship by eighteen points. Racing the BR Performance #91R HD Industries / Lee & Norma Leonard Maxim, Roa scored third at Ventura on May 7th. To date, the defending 360 Western World Champion has three top-10 finishes on the season. This Saturday, Brody will be looking for his second career USAC/CRA feature win.

Richard Vander Weerd (Visalia, California) is second in the USAC/CRA point standings. Piloting the family owned #10 Vander Weerd Construction / Stone Gate Development Maxim, Richard placed eighth at Ventura Raceway. Heading to Perris, the 2011 USAC West Coast Champion has two heat race victories, three top-10 finishes, and 21 feature laps led to his credit. Vander Weerd will have his sights on making this year’s “Salute to Indy” this sixth USAC/CRA win of his career.

After running second to Troy Rutherford at Ventura, Mike Spencer (Temecula, California) has climbed to third in the point chase. Making his debut in his fourth ride in as many races, the driver of the Gansen Engineering Motorsports’ #4S Trench Shoring / Baldozier Racing Maxim has three top-10 finishes and 21 feature laps led on the year. The five-time champion won the 2012 “Salute to Indy” and will be looking to claim his 38th win this Saturday.

Jake Swanson (Anaheim, California) sits fourth in the USAC/CRA point standings. Driving Tom and Laurie Sertich's #92 Huntington Beach Glass & Mirror / Clackamas Rigging & Transfer Victory, Swanson earned the Woodland Auto Display Fast Time Award and ran sixth at Ventura. To date, the 2012 Rookie of the Year has one heat race victory, one Brown & Miller Racing Solutions Semi-Main win, and three top-10 finishes. This Saturday, Jake will have his sights on his first USAC/CRA triumph at Perris Auto Speedway.

“The Demon” Damion Gardner (Concord, California) has risen to fifth in the championship standings. Racing Mark Alexander’s #4 Scott Sales Company / Weld Racing Spike, Gardner scored fourth in the Ventura main event. Heading to Perris, the four-time and defending series champion has two top-10 finishes and 20 feature laps led on the year. “The Demon” won the 2003 & 2004 “Salute to Indy” and will be looking to earn his series leading 66th victory.

Currently ranked seventh in points, Max Adams (Loomis, California) leads the chase for Rookie of the Year honors. Trent Williams (Victorville, California), Andrew Sweeney (Lomita, California), and Mikey Lovas (Wildomar, California) are also in contention.
